A lawsuit brought against asbestos companies aims to make them accountable for the harm they cause. The two main types of mesothelioma lawsuits are personal injury and wrongful death. Both seek to compensate mesothelioma victims and their families. However the personal injury lawsuit is more likely to be settled faster than a wrongful-death lawsuit.

Mesothelioma victims can get compensation through three sources: asbestos trust funds, lawsuits and settlements. Asbestos trust funds are put up by bankrupt asbestos companies to ensure their victims and their families receive compensation for asbestos-related illnesses. A successful mesothelioma compensation claim can pay victims within 90 days or less. The amount of compensation will depend on a range of factors, including the way in which the case is analyzed and which mesothelioma trust fund to file the claim. Expedited reviews offer a quick payment for claims that meet pre-set requirements, while individual reviews take an in-depth look into the case.

The length of a mesothelioma lawsuit can differ based on the compensation sought. In many cases, defendants in mesothelioma lawsuits will agree to settle to avoid expensive litigation and the risk of losing the whole case. If the defendants aren't willing to settle, it could take more than a year before the verdict of a trial is reached.

In the case of a verdict in a trial, the jury will determine who is liable and pay compensation to the victim or their family. Compensation is typically paid out in monthly installments rather than a lump sum.

Asbestos victims can receive different amounts of compensation depending on how their case is reviewed by the mesothelioma trust fund. If the claim is in line with certain criteria that it will be compensated an amount that is fixed under expedited reviews. Individual reviews will look at the claim in greater depth before determining its value.
